Make the colored border around worlds in the Worlds tab brighter and more obvious
Describe the Underlying Issue
While explaining to a new user how to use the Worlds tab to see what worlds they're currently in, I finally noticed that worlds you're in have a faint yellow border, active sessions have a pinkish border, and published but inactive worlds have a blue border.
They do get brighter on hover, but these aren't super obvious at a glance. I think it would help make the worlds tab a little less daunting to navigate if these were larger and brighter.

Expected Behavior
I think if it was a bit larger and brighter it would be a more obvious signal. I've been staring at this for two years and only just now noticed the distinction. In fact, I think I only noticed it because a bunch of my world previews aren't loading right now.
Consideration towards colorblindness feels important here as well; perhaps dashes, notches, or a shaped glow could work well here.
Documenting this in the Help tab seems prudent, too; the current text there for the Worlds tab is barebones. I could write up some copy for this if that would help.
